Project Story: MindfulMoments - A Mental Wellness Application
Inspiration
The inspiration for MindfulMoments stemmed from the increasing need for accessible mental wellness tools in today's fast-paced world. The pressures of daily life can often lead to stress and anxiety, and I wanted to create an application that would provide users with practical methods to improve their mental health.
What it Does
MindfulMoments offers a variety of features designed to enhance mental well-being, including:
- Guided meditation sessions with customizable durations.
- Breathing exercises to help users relax and focus.
- Mood tracking to help users monitor their emotional state over time.
- Additional features like reminders, soothing background sounds, and tips for mindfulness practices.
How We Built It
MindfulMoments was developed using React Native for the front-end, enabling smooth operation on both iOS and Android devices. The back-end was powered by Node.js and Express, providing robust data handling and API management. Firebase was used for real-time database storage and user authentication, ensuring that user data is secure and accessible across devices.
Challenges We Ran Into
One of the major challenges was optimizing the app's performance while integrating various features. Ensuring that the app runs smoothly without draining device resources was critical. Another challenge was designing an intuitive user interface that made the app easy to navigate while offering rich functionalities.
Accomplishments That We're Proud Of
We are proud of successfully creating an app that not only runs efficiently across multiple platforms but also provides users with a valuable tool for improving their mental health. The seamless integration of features like mood tracking and customizable meditations was a significant accomplishment.
What We Learned
Throughout the development process, we gained deeper insights into mindfulness practices and their importance in daily life. Technically, we improved our skills in mobile app development, particularly in user experience design, state management, and performance optimization.
What's Next for MindfulMoments - A Mental Wellness Application
Looking ahead, we plan to enhance MindfulMoments by adding new features such as:
- Community support groups within the app.
- Personalized meditation recommendations based on user preferences.
- Integration with wearable devices to track real-time health metrics.
- Expanding the app’s content library with more guided meditations and mindfulness resources.
We are excited about the future of MindfulMoments and its potential to positively impact users' mental wellness journeys.
Log in or sign up for Devpost to join the conversation.